All bays (permit, shared use and pay & display) operate 9am to 8pm Monday to Sunday including Bank Holidays. Always check the street signs before you park.
Visitor permit cost: £3.50, valid for one calendar day (residents permitted 50 a year).
Resident parking permit for non-diesel, normal emission vehicles producing between 111g/km - 165g/km CO2 cost: £130 annual, £45 for 3 months.
Non-diesel, low emission vehicles producing 110g/km or less CO2 cost: £65 annual, £22.50 for 3 months.
Diesel or high emission vehicles producing 166g/km or more CO2 cost: £163 annual, £57 for 3 months.
Fiveways is a family area. Outside of central Brighton but close enough to make town easily accessible, there are good schools, big houses and great parks.It's a village in itself. There's a traditional greengrocer, butcher & deli, with plenty of green space nearby – Blakers Park, Preston Park and access to the South Downs via Ditchling Road.Fiveways is where people come to settle down in a family home, but still want everything Brighton has to offer.
